Ingredients

 
Flour - 2 cups
 
Sugar - 1/2 cup
 
Baking powder - 2 1/2 teaspoons
 
Eggs - 2
 
Melted butter - 2 tablespoons
 
Milk - 1/2 cup
 
Coffee - 1/3 cup, strong
 
Vanilla extract - 1 teaspoon
 
Hazelnut spread

Directions

GETTING READY
1)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
2) Line up muffin sheet with silicone or paper cups.

MAKING
3) In bowl mix flour, sugar and baking powder.
4) In a separate bowl lightly beat eggs, add milk, coffee, vanilla extract and melted butter and mix together.
5) Add the milk mixture to flour mixture and mix well. Be careful not to over mix.
6) Fill every cup to half of its volume. Add teaspoon of hazelnuts spread at the center and then add the remaining of batter to fill each cup.
7)Cook for about 25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into muffins edges comes out clean.
8) Remove from the oven and enjoy!

SERVING
9) Serve hot with some tea.
